Well sure - and the controversy wasn't so much as black people being depicted in a poor light, or depicted as slaves - because that was fact. It was more that the screen play was originally called The Clansman and celebrated the KKK as heroes and applauded slavery.

You don't need to be teetering on the far far left to see how that title might no be the best way to advertise your product ;)

(The fact is that the film is still celebrated for other reasons - it was ground breaking in developing cinematic techniques still used to this day - it was the first to feature wide panoramic and moving shots, tight close ups, and must score written for orchestra - among many other innovations)

I wanted to reveal one of the clues hidden on the AoS. Mainly because it ties into many of the other clues. Without knowing what you're looking for, you'll never be able to find it.

While the placement of the lanterns within the Liberty Tree may not look unusual at first glance... look again. The lanterns form something called the "Tree of Life" which can be found throughout history in various cultures and religions.
